Hi Free ,  I was on (10 per day )  10mg Norco for needed pain relief , just could not stop after surgery eased my pain .
I am in good shape for my age but at 65 trying to go CT off 100mg a day was to tuff on me after going 3 days crying  i gave up . Bloodpressure was sky high . That day i went on this site and learned more about tapering .
Thank God these people helped me i was sick , lost , hateing my life . Wife starting to complain .
Well i started by hearing that it would take a few days for my body to adjust to each lowering of my dose say 5-7 days so i tried to cut by 25% per week .Found it tuff but do able , For me  easyer then CT i was in a bit of discomfort not easy but it was do able for me.
Went a little over 3 weeks weaning ,maybe a bit to fast but i wanted off this Crap  Was so scared of jumping it took a girls message that she ran out of norco tapering pills and jumped . That did it i said if a girl can do it so can i. ( true story )
Trust me on this The fear is worse to live with then the W/D itself 100 hours of W/D & it should start to feel like your WINNING this FIGHT .
On my Day #10 & think i had it easy this far , compaired to my CT try. feeling so much better , wanting , doing things again , feeling good . even hungry again .
Read the Thomas recipe below botton of the page . Think it helps .
I drank a ton of Ensure when i just could not make my self eat . I like it ice cold i think it made my tummy feel better .

Be careful not to become TOO confident and TOO complacent, that's how people fall on their face, and not even realize what happened.  You're JUST coming off the Norco.  A week clean means you still may have some of the drug in your system...meaning...be careful, this is all fresh, and new.  It's great to want to give back, but I've seen people (on various forums) get very caught up in that, when THEIR issue hasn't been resolved yet, and they realize, oh CRAP!  What was I DOING?  I was in NO place to be be advising people when I didn't know what *I* was even doing yet!

People for sure will want to hear your experiences and opinions, however, it's a bit premature to be trying to figure out the most efficient way to run the forum.  Most of the regular have been here for YEARS, through MANY changes, format changes, rule changes, you name it.  Like everyone said, it's working.  People are getting help AND aupport, without just having a bunch of links thrown at them, or a standard copy/paste reply which is cold and impersonal.

You could always offer a brief personal message, and then point the people in the right direction, tell them to browse the forum, etc.  For a lot of people, navigating the site is very difficult at first, they have NO clue what a health page is, or where to find it.  Add to that most people are in 100% crisis mode.

Just post from your heart, but again, very wise advice to continue concentrating PRIMARILY on YOU.  You can ease into the role of advice giver after you've spent some time on YOU.
